Kim Kardashian is opening up about her terrifying ordeal in Paris last October when she was tied up and robbed of jewelry worth $11 million.
In a preview of next Sunday’s episode of Keeping Up With the Kardashians, a tearful Kim Kardashian recounts how her assailants threatened her with a gun and how she thought there was “no way out.”
The reality TV star says the robbers demanded cash and then became physical. “They dragged me out on to the hallway on top of the stairs,” she said in the clip posted by E! “That’s when I saw the gun clear, like clear as day. I was kind of looking at the gun, looking down back at the stairs.”
Kardashian is seen telling her concerned sisters, Khloe and Kourtney, that she had only a second to decide what to do next.
“I was like; ‘I have a split second in my mind to make this quick decision,'” she said. “Am I going to run down the stairs and either be shot in the back? It makes me so upset to think about it. Either they’re going to shoot me in the back, or if I make it and they don’t, if the elevator does not open in time, or the stairs are locked, then like I’m f—ed. There’s no way out.”
According to reports, 17 people were arrested in connection with the Oct. 3 crime. Watch the clip below.
